Examples include an eye injury, sudden vision loss or a head injury. There are 13 various parts to a complete (comprehensive) eye test. Seven of the eye test elements focus on how your eyes work and exactly how they appear on the outside. Those components are:. This section checks just how well you see.
That graph has a large letter or icon at the top, and each line of letters/symbols obtains progressively smaller sized the further down the chart you go. This component checks exactly how well you see in each various section of your line of vision in each eye. It can detect voids or unseen areas that should not be there.
Your company will certainly check each eye by itself and after that both eyes together. In this component, your copyright checks out the conjunctiva, a thin, clear membrane layer that covers the white location (sclera) of your eye and the within your eyelids. The ocular adnexa consists of all the parts of your eye and face that aren't the eyeball itself.
Looking at it with a slit light lets your copyright see if it's in good condition., the iris and the lens.

Your professional will take a look at the lens's clarity and framework. Your professional will certainly check out the optic disk (where the optic nerve affixes to the eyeball) and the optic cup (the bowl-shaped factor at the facility of the disk). They'll additionally examine the cup-to-disk proportion. If the ratio is reduced, it can show a greater danger of problems like ischemic optic neuropathy.
The 13th eye examination component rotates around exactly how well your brain is working. It's not always part of an eye examination, but it can be very essential in some circumstances.

After a regular eye examination, your eye treatment professional will certainly clarify what they located and what it means for you.
Federal laws need that they provide you a paper or digital copy, even if you don't want it. A couple of states additionally need that the paper copy of the prescription include your pupillary distance (the distance in between the students of your eyes), which you require to acquire glasses online. Numerous states don't require providers to give you that measurement, yet some providers will offer it to you if you ask.
